Career Path

The Global Certificate in GIS for Epidemiology prepares students for various exciting roles in the UK job market. This 3D pie chart highlights the percentage of professionals in four major positions, demonstrating the demand for GIS skills in epidemiology. GIS Data Analysts, with 30% of the market share, collect, analyze, and visualize geospatial data for public health research. Their expertise is invaluable for tracking disease patterns and predicting outbreaks. Epidemiologists, holding 40% of the positions, study disease spread, identify risk factors, and implement strategies to control outbreaks. GIS skills enhance their ability to monitor and analyze health data geographically. GIS Specialists in Public Health, accounting for 20% of the roles, focus on integrating GIS technologies into public health systems for better data management, visualization, and decision-making. Lastly, GIS Developers for Epidemiology, with 10% of the positions, create custom GIS applications and tools, which enable the efficient collection, analysis, and mapping of public health data. These roles showcase the strong job market trends and growing demand for GIS professionals in epidemiology, offering promising career opportunities in the UK.
